I have no clue. What is the Cooperative extension service?
I'm pressed for time right now, but please remind me to circle back to this topic.

Basically, the extension service takes university research in a wide range of areas, and makes it meaningful, usable, and USEFUL to the end users (farmers, homeowners, pet owners, gardeners, etc.) The extension service takes the research and translates it into How-To.
